Moses Bliss begins ‘Expression World Tour’ with electrifying Paris performance before heading to Australia

After months of eager anticipation from fans worldwide, gospel music sensation and worship leader Moses Bliss has officially commenced his highly anticipated ‘Expression World Tour.’

The global spiritual journey began with an unforgettable and spirit-filled concert in Paris, France, signalling the start of what promises to be a profound movement of divine encounter across continents.

The tour, a direct extension of Moses Bliss’ critically acclaimed 16-track album, The Expression, released earlier this year, features powerful collaborations with renowned artists such as Sunmisola Agbebi, Nathaniel Bassey, and Chandler Moore, among others. The Parisian leg of the tour, held on Saturday, July 12, at the prestigious Cité Royale, was nothing short of extraordinary.

Worshippers from various parts of Europe converged in the heart of Paris for what many attendees described as a night of intense divine encounter. The atmosphere was charged with heartfelt worship, high praise, and a palpable sense of God’s presence, leaving a lasting impact on all who were present.

The Paris experience, however, is merely the opening chapter of this expansive tour. Moses Bliss is now poised to carry the same anointing and musical fervour to other parts of the world. His next stops are slated for Australia and New Zealand, with a series of concerts scheduled for:

Perth: July 23

Brisbane: July 24

Melbourne: July 25

Sydney: July 26

Auckland, New Zealand: July 27

Fans in Europe and Africa can also look forward to announcements of more cities in the coming weeks, as the tour continues its global outreach.

Speaking on the inspiration behind this monumental tour, Moses Bliss shared, “For a long time now, I’ve been receiving messages, DMs, comments, and emails from people all over the world asking, ‘When are you coming to our city?’ I believe this is that moment. God has opened the door, and this tour is an answer to many of those requests and prayers. I’m excited to bring God’s presence through music to these places and connect with its amazing people.”

The ‘Expression Tour’ transcends the conventional concert experience; it is envisioned as a powerful call to worship, a profound celebration of grace, and a timely reminder that music, when deeply rooted in faith, serves as a potent vessel for healing, spiritual revival, and unadulterated joy.
